Lately, I’ve been doing a lot of reflecting on what I choose to put on my body. Tattooing is an art form, but for me, it has shifted into something much deeper—a reflection of my faith. I’ve felt a strong conviction a few years ago that if I’m adding any tattoos, any artwork I put on my skin needs to be entirely rooted in God and Biblical truth.
I know that making your faith the sole focus of your tattoos isn’t always the most "popular" or trendy path across the board. Nor in some eyes are tattoos at all a popular decision.
In a community with so many different styles and subcultures, choosing to dedicate that space exclusively to Christ can feel like swimming against the current.
But there is something so beautiful about creating stencils that carry eternal weight. Whether it’s scripture, powerful Biblical imagery, or symbols of His grace, every line becomes a testament to what He has done in my life.
It’s not about following a trend; it’s about a personal commitment to carry His word with me wherever I go.
